ESC G n
[Name]
Turn on/off double-strike mode
[Format]
ASCII ESC G n
Hex 1B 47 n
Decimal 27 71 n
[Range]
0
n
255
[Description] Turns double-strike mode on or off.
When the LSB of n is 0, double-strike mode is turned off.
When the LSB of n is 1, double-strike mode is turned on.
[Notes]
Only the lowest bit of n is enabled.
Printer output is the same in double-strike mode and in emphasized mode.
[Default]
n = 0
[Reference]
ESC E
ESC J n
[Name]
Print and feed paper
[Format]
ASCII ESC J n
Hex
1B 4A n
Decimal 27 74 n
[Range]
0
n
255
[Description] Prints the data in the print buffer and feeds the paper [n
×
0.125 mm].
[Notes]
After printing is completed, this command sets the print starting position to the
beginning of the line.
The paper feed amount set by this command does not affect the values set by
ESC
2
or
ESC 3
.
In standard mode, the printer uses the vertical motion unit (y).
Even when the set value exceeds the maximum with the Black Mark sensor
enabled in standard mode, this command is effective.
